預計到 2025 年,電纜工具鑽孔市場規模將達到 31.24 億美元,到 2030 年將達到 38.24 億美元,複合年成長率為 4.13%。

鋼絲繩鑽井是最古老的鑽井技術之一,它透過反覆升降由鋼纜吊掛的重型鑽頭,利用衝擊力破碎岩石。該工具通常配備切割籃,用於收集碎屑。鋼絲繩鑽井設備在19世紀阿巴拉契亞地區率先用於油井鑽探,如今仍因其獨特的操作優勢而備受青睞。這些優點包括:單人即可操作、與更現代的系統相比,初始投資成本相對較低,以及結構簡單且堅固耐用,維護需求極低。這些特性使得該技術在石油天然氣和採礦業得以持續應用,並在細分市場中展現出巨大的成長潛力。

電纜鑽井工具市場的主要驅動力是全球對水井日益成長的需求。隨著地表水資源壓力增加和枯竭,人們對地下水資源的依賴性日益增強。全球人口的成長加劇了這一趨勢,預計這將導致水資源競爭更加激烈,尤其是在農業領域。確保透過水井獲得可靠的水源對於滿足不斷成長的糧食生產需求至關重要。電纜鑽井工具不僅被公認為一種有效的水井開發方法,而且在某些情況下也具有卓越的效率。其快速的鑽井線移動能力使其在某些應用中優於其他開發方法。因此,全球對水井建設日益成長的需求預計將直接推動電纜鑽井工具的需求。

此外,在某些淺層鑽井應用中,鋼絲繩鑽井的成本效益是推動市場發展的主要因素。此技術主要用於軟岩層和鬆散地層的鑽井,特別適用於需要相對較淺井的場合。雖然其鑽速通常低於旋轉鑽井,但由於其整體成本更低、操作更簡便,仍然是許多計劃的首選技術。鋼絲繩鑽井工具的衝擊作用能夠有效去除岩體並穿透各種土壤類型中的堅硬地層。此外,它們還可以用於鑽探至地下水層深處,或穿透一個含水層到達另一個含水層。低初始投資、操作簡便以及堅固耐用、維護成本低的設計,使其在淺井鑽探領域具有極高的提案,從而推動了該細分市場的成長。

然而,儘管存在這些市場促進因素,傳統鋼絲繩鑽機仍面臨一些固有的挑戰,限制了其市場擴張。作為一項較老的技術,它缺乏旋轉鑽井中常見的現代流體循環系統,後者能夠持續清除井眼中的碎屑。這導致鑽井過程中需要定期停工,用犁刀手動清除積聚的碎屑,從而降低了整體效率。此外,該技術在鑽井深度和井孔直徑方面也存在操作限制。兩者之間存在反比關係,雖然中等直徑的井眼可以達到合理的鑽井深度,但隨著井眼直徑的增大,鑽柱和鋼絲繩的重量會迅速超過鑽機的承載能力,從而在初期限制了可達到的鑽井深度。其他缺點還包括鑽速普遍較慢,以及在某些地質條件下,如果沒有專用設備,可能難以回收較長的套管柱。

從終端用戶細分來看,鋼絲繩鑽井技術在石油和天然氣產業持續應用,主要用於鑽探超淺井。它也用於水井和某些探勘作業。全球對石油和天然氣探勘(包括針對淺層蘊藏量的計劃)的持續需求將繼續推動鋼絲繩鑽井技術的發展。經濟成長和能源消費量的增加正在推動探勘活動的增加,尤其是在鋼絲繩鑽井技術具有成本效益和操作簡便性的情況下。儘管鋼絲繩鑽井技術具有其獨特性,但這些因素可能會鞏固其市場地位,尤其是在淺水井和一些特殊的石油和天然氣應用領域,因為在這些領域,其經濟性和操作特性與計劃需求相契合。

The cable tool drilling market, at a 4.13% CAGR, is projected to increase from USD 3.124 billion in 2025 to USD 3.824 billion in 2030.

Cable tool drilling, one of the oldest drilling techniques, operates by repeatedly lifting and dropping a heavy bit suspended by a steel cable to break rock through percussion. The tool is often fitted with a cuttings basket to collect debris. As the first method used for drilling oil wells, notably in the Appalachian region during the 19th century, cable tool rigs maintain relevance today due to their distinct operational advantages. These include the potential for one-person operation, relatively low equipment costs compared to more modern systems, and a straightforward, robust design that requires minimal maintenance. These characteristics contribute to the technique's continued use and potential for niche market growth within the oil and gas and mining sectors.

A significant driver for the cable tool drilling market is the rising global demand for water wells. As surface water resources face increasing pressure and decline, the reliance on underground water sources is growing. This trend is exacerbated by a rising global population, which is projected to create intense competition for water resources, particularly for agricultural needs. To meet the demand for increased food production, the development of reliable water access via wells becomes critical. Cable tool drilling is recognized not only as an effective method for developing wells but also for its efficiency in certain contexts; the rapid movement of the drill lines can make it superior to other development forms for specific applications. The escalating need for water well construction worldwide is therefore expected to directly fuel demand for the cable tool drilling method.

Furthermore, the cost-effectiveness of cable tool drilling for specific shallow drilling applications serves as a key market booster. This method is predominantly utilized for drilling in soft rock formations and unconsolidated materials where relatively shallow wells are required. While the penetration rates are characteristically slower than those of rotary drilling, the technique remains preferred for numerous projects due to its lower overall cost and operational simplicity. The percussion action of the cable tool is effective at removing boulders and breaking through tougher formations within various soil types. Additionally, it can drill deeper into water tables and even penetrate through one aquifer to reach another. The combination of low initial equipment investment, simple operation, and a robust, low-maintenance design creates a compelling value proposition for shallow well drilling, helping to fuel market growth in this segment.

Despite these drivers, the traditional cable tool method faces inherent challenges that constrain its broader market growth. As a legacy technique, it lacks the modern fluid circulation systems found in rotary drilling that continuously remove rock cuttings from the borehole. This necessitates periodic halts in drilling to manually remove accumulated debris using bailers, which inherently reduces overall efficiency. The technique also imposes operational limitations on well depth and diameter. The relationship is inverse; achieving a reasonable depth is possible with a modest diameter, but the weight of the drill string and cable for larger diameters can quickly exceed the machine's capacity, limiting the achievable depth from the outset. Other disadvantages include a generally slow rate of penetration and potential difficulties in retrieving long casing strings in certain geological conditions without specialized equipment.

Regarding end-user segmentation, the cable tool drilling method continues to find application within the oil and gas sector, primarily for drilling extremely shallow wells. It is also used in water wells and in specific exploration contexts. The ongoing global need for oil and natural gas exploration, including projects targeting shallow reserves, is expected to provide continued scope for the use of cable tool drilling. As economies grow and energy consumption increases, exploration activities are intensified, which can include scenarios where the cost-effectiveness and simplicity of cable tool drilling are advantageous. These factors indicate that while it is a specialized technique, cable tool drilling will maintain a presence in the market, particularly for shallow water wells and niche oil and gas applications where its economic and operational characteristics align with project requirements.
